No country for face masks: Nordics brush off mouth covers

No country for face masks: Nordics brush off mouth covers

As most of the world either orders or recommends the use of face masks, with even US President, Donald Trump, seen wearing one, Nordic nations are the remaining holdouts. Peru passes 400,000 coronavirus cases

Peru passes 400,000 coronavirus cases

Peru on Wednesday passed 400,000 confirmed coronavirus cases, the health ministry said, after the largest daily increase in infections for more than six weeks. COVID-19: Four out of 50 persons arrested in Kwara night club test positive

COVID-19: Four out of 50 persons arrested in Kwara night club test positive

Four out of the 50 people arrested in the early hours of July 18 at a night club in Ilorin by the Kwara Technical Committee on COVID-19 have tested positive for the virus.
